Texas de Brazil, is a Brazilian steakhouse, or churrascaria, that features endless servings of flame-grilled beef, lamb, pork, chicken, and Brazilian sausage as well as an extravagant salad area with a wide array of seasonal chef-crafted items.

The Gregory at The Watermark Hotel is Baton Rouge, Louisiana's premier destination for modern food & wine. Located off the lobby of the hotel, in the former Bank of Louisiana, our restaurant is centered between an open kitchen and a full bar surrounded by murals painted by the artist of who the restaurant is named, Angela Gregory. Chefs Patrick Trahan, Brock Nichols, and Jonathan White design menus that utilize fresh and local produce and available organic proteins that offer twists on Southern classics in a modern farm-to-table menu. As a Louisiana native, Patrick influences Southern cooking styles by employing our wood-stone oven, Spanish Josper oven, and cast-iron grill to elevate flavors and create one-of-a-kind dishes in the downtown Baton Rouge area.
